Clinical Psychologist (Autism & ADHD)
Location: UK (Home Based)
Salary: Very Competitive + Excellent Benefits
Job Type: Part Time, Monday - Friday, 8 am - 6 pm
Home-based with occasional travel
The Client:
Our client’s Healthcare Company is one of the UK’s leading providers of occupational health services. Established by a group of occupational health professionals, they have experienced strong, steady growth. Their clients include leading names across a wide range of sectors.
The Role:
As a Clinical Psychologist, you will lead the diagnostic service within the Health Partners Neurodiversity Service. You will provide post-diagnostic support, deliver training sessions, and offer neuro affirming workplace recommendations. Your expertise will contribute to the development of Neurodiversity services, ensuring a neuro affirming approach across the organisation.
Responsibilities:
- Conduct diagnostic assessments for autistic adults and individuals with ADHD, integrating data from various sources.
- Compile accurate and comprehensive reports.
- Provide post-diagnostic support, training sessions, and neuro affirming workplace recommendations.
- Contribute to team KPI targets and meet SLAs for report submissions.
- Offer expertise in autism and ADHD, delivering training and supervision to staff.
- Stay updated with published research and best practices.
- Independently interpret guidelines and policies, consulting peers or supervisors when necessary.
- Conduct workplace needs assessments for autistic employees, identifying strengths and barriers and making suitable recommendations.
Requirements:
- Previous experience working as a Psychologist, Clinical Psychologist or in a similar role.
- HCPC-registered Clinical Psychologist.
- Post-graduate doctoral level in Clinical Psychology.
- Substantial post-qualification experience with autism and ADHD.
- Accredited DISCO/ADI-R/ADOS or equivalent diagnostic assessment qualification.
